Caroline Walters
M.A. Candidate in Public Diplomacy
Foreign Affairs Fellow at U.S. Dept. of State


Caroline "Carrie" Walters is a student in the Master's program in Public Diplomacy at USC. Prior to this, Carrie served as Program Coordinator for the Washington, D.C. office of Transparency International. She also spent a year teaching English at a Japanese high school through the Japan Exchange and Teaching (JET) Programme, and completed a research assistantship with Member of Parliament, Ian Cawsey, at the House of Commons in London. A graduate of the University of Notre Dame, Walters is a recipient of the Thomas R. Pickering Graduate Foreign Affairs Fellowship from the U.S. Department of State where she is currently interning.
